II.1.4) Disgrifiad byr
Crown Commercial Service is setting up a dynamic purchasing system for an initial period of 48 months. CCS is inviting bidders to request to participate in the Digital Inclusion and Support DPS. This DPS will provide central government and wider public sector departments the opportunity to find and procure a range of services relating to assisted digital support and digital inclusion support.
The three distinct categories of the DPS service filters are support type, delivery method and location.
If you are successfully appointed to the DPS following your submission you will be invited by customers (buyers) to submit tenders for relevant services through a call for competition. This DPS remains open for any supplier to request to participate throughout the duration of the DPS. CCS reserves the right to reduce, extend or terminate the DPS period at any time during its lifetime in accordance with the terms set out in the DPS contract.

II.2.4) Disgrifiad o’r caffaeliad
The RM6209 Digital Inclusion and Support DPS contract will facilitate the commissioning of assisted digital and digital inclusion services that:
— give freedom and flexibility to service owners such as government bodies and local authorities to define their requirements as outcomes that meet their assisted digital and/or digital inclusion users’ needs;
— creates a competitive commercial environment in which all service providers have an equal opportunity to thrive;
— places the right value on service providers’ capabilities and remunerates them accordingly;
— supports and encourages innovation and continuous improvement in service delivery;
— supports and encourages strong collaboration across all sectors:
• central and local government,
• wider public sector organisations,
• private sector organisations (whether large, SME or micro suppliers),
• VCSE sector organisations.
The Digital Inclusion and Support DPS contract is intended to replace some of the elements available under a previous commercial agreement RM 3765 — digital training and support framework.
(https://www.crowncommercial.gov.uk/agreements/RM3765).

On 2 April 2014 Government introduced its Government Security Classifications (GSC) scheme which replaced government protective marking scheme (GPMS). A key aspect is the reduction in the number of security classifications used. All bidders should make themselves aware of the changes as it may impact on this requirement.The link below to Gov.uk provides information on the GSC at:
https://www.gov.uk/government/publications/government-security-classifications
Cyber essentials is a mandatory requirement for central government contracts which involve handling personal information or provide certain ICT products/services. Government is taking steps to reduce the levels of cyber security risk in its supply chain through the cyber essentials scheme. The scheme defines a set of controls which, when implemented, will provide organisations with basic protection from the most prevalent forms of threat coming from the internet. To participate in this procurement, bidders must be able to demonstrate they comply with the technical requirements prescribed by cyber essentials, for services under and in connection with this procurement.
